Gakkou Gurashi 01

I really appreciate all the effort they went to making this seem as unassuming as possible, right down to the OST. They even got Mosaic.wav to do music for it! If that's not dedication, I don't know what is. I especially liked that Yuki's classmates didn't look like background characters,
fooling the viewer into thinking that they'd be more than just figments of Yuki's mind, leading them down entirely the wrong path.
The little hints sprinkled throughout were great too - the
broken windows in the hallway that were only visible for a second, the grave marker in the bed of crops, The Stand, the notes on the blackboard...
all of them were really well done I thought, and had I not
already known what was going to happen I probably would have been fooled.

Having read some of the manga, I found that I spent most of the episode wondering when they were going to do it and how they were going to do it - the execution of the twist was different from how it was done in the manga, and I personally prefer how it was done there. Instead of a
slow reveal of reality I was expecting more a jump cut between Yuki's delusion of the world and what reality actually looks like, with the delusion having lots in the way of chatter from students, peppy music along with Yuki's dialogue, then cutting away to reality with all audio cut apart from Yuki's one-sided conversation.
That was really my only disappointment, though.

Classroom Crisis 02

The intro gives an excuse of why the hell a megacoorp has a high school, even if it's a specialized one like theirs, it's a tradition related to the founding of the company.

In any case, this is a typical second episode, in the sense that the first tried catch our attention with more flash and fury, and this slow down things as it's time to do some exposition (in the shape of a tv documentary even), in both the setting and in the specifics of the situation of the protagonists. Not the most thrilling episode.

The teacher getting teary with his own previous speech was funny and pathetic.

The plot seems fairly straightforward. I predict something like: super serious, cutthroat and hardworking boss/transfer student has the orders of dismantling the class, but over the course of the series he discovers friendship and teamwork and the value of the class blah blah blah and at some point turn sides and will help the class to survive. Well, it will be also because he is at odds with his bigger brother, who clearly want to dispose of him as he sees him as a menace in the company, so if he can get successful with the division and thanks to that ascend in the corporate ladder and at the same time sticking it up to his brother, even better. I suppose it will be a mix of these two narrative threads.
